About the Role
CalcAir Employee Benefit Systems, Inc. is seeking a highly skilled and motivated Enrolled Actuary to serve on our Actuarial Support team, alongside a team of accredited specialists, including actuarial and other professionals. This role is designed to strengthen our customer support capabilities and contribute to the development, implementation, and testing of software features that empower our clients in the small plan retirement market. The ideal candidate will have deep experience with combo plans (DB/DC) and defined contribution administration, and will collaborate closely with our actuarial, support, and development teams.
Some of the Tasks
Provide expert guidance on combo plan design, compliance, and administration
Support customer inquiries and troubleshoot plan-specific issues with precision and clarity
Collaborate with software developers to propose and refine features that enhance plan administration tools
Participate in testing and validation of new software functionalities, ensuring actuarial accuracy and usability
Contribute to training materials and client education initiatives related to retirement plan features
Assist in interpreting regulatory changes and translating them into actionable system updates
Offer insights during product planning sessions to align actuarial needs with technical capabilities
About you
EA designation required, with current enrollment status
Minimum 5 years of experience in retirement plan administration, with a focus on combo plans including DC administration
Strong understanding of ERISA, IRS, and DOL regulations applicable to small retirement plans
Proven ability to communicate complex actuarial concepts to non-actuarial audiences
Experience working with retirement plan software platforms and contributing to feature development
Excellent organizational, analytical, and problem-solving skills
Proficiency in Microsoft Office and familiarity with data analysis tools
Prior experience in a client-facing support role
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ment
Commitment to continuous learning and professional development
